    Grew up in the 60's when they were burning alewives at the beach heads on lake huron because they were a nuisance . Watched them pile em' up with bulldozers and light em' on fire with diesel. Caught the very first coho when they averaged ~17lbs then the kings (35lbers) came and decimated the lake. It was a h3ll of a run until mid 2000's. These have and will always be invasive species a dieing breed in our lakes.
